]> git.netwichtig.de Git - user/henk/code/inspircd.git/blobdiff - win/rename_installer.pl
Show SSL fingerprint in /WHOIS line, allow fingerprints to be hidden from non-opers...
[user/henk/code/inspircd.git] / win / rename_installer.pl
index 678b11b8bf475d134c22248161f5ac50a74961b3..d24abb995f292892527cfa1892895694a39a9fa9 100644 (file)
@@ -7,17 +7,22 @@ while (chomp($v = <FH>))
 }\r
 close FH;\r
 \r
-$version =~ /InspIRCd-(\d+)\.(\d+)\.(\d+)([ab\+])/;\r
+print "Version: '$version'\n";\r
+\r
+$version =~ /InspIRCd-(\d+)\.(\d+)\.(\d+)([ab\+]|RC|rc)/;\r
 \r
 $v1 = $1;\r
 $v2 = $2;\r
 $v3 = $3;\r
 $type = $4;\r
 \r
-if ($type =~ /^[ab]$/)\r
+print "v1=$1 v2=$2 v3=$3 type=$4\n";\r
+\r
+if ($type =~ /^[ab]|rc|RC$/)\r
 {\r
-       $version =~ /InspIRCd-\d+\.\d+\.\d+[ab\+](\d+)/;\r
-       $alphabeta = $1;\r
+       $version =~ /InspIRCd-\d+\.\d+\.\d+([ab]|RC|rc)(\d+)/;\r
+       $alphabeta = $2;\r
+       print "Version sub is $type $alphabeta\n";\r
        $name = "InspIRCd-$v1.$v2.$v3$type$alphabeta.exe";\r
        $rel = "$v1.$v2.$v3$type$alphabeta";\r
 }\r
@@ -29,6 +34,7 @@ else
 \r
 print "del $name\n";\r
 print "ren Setup.exe $name\n";\r
+\r
 system("del $name");\r
 system("ren Setup.exe $name");\r
 \r